summaryrefslogtreecommitdiffhomepage
path: root/windows/nsis-plugins/src/driverlogic/context.cpp
AgeCommit message (Expand)AuthorFilesLines
2020-01-31Refactor driverlogicDavid Lönnhager1-530/+0
2020-01-31Delete old-ID Mullvad TAP on updatesDavid Lönnhager1-7/+8
2020-01-31Update TAP driver detailsDavid Lönnhager1-1/+1
2020-01-28Use new exception macrosOdd Stranne1-18/+52
2020-01-02Skip TAP adapters whose names or attributes cannot be read instead of failingDavid Lönnhager1-8/+21
2019-12-16Add more logging to driverlogicDavid Lönnhager1-18/+8
2019-12-03Move InterfaceUtils into shared library, and move Nci into libcommonDavid Lönnhager1-14/+6
2019-12-03More specific error logs in IdentifyNewAdapterDavid Lönnhager1-2/+8
2019-12-03Roll back TAP aliases after TAP driver updates (Windows)David Lönnhager1-0/+20
2019-12-03driverlogic: Obtain additional information about TAP adapters using SetupAPI ...David Lönnhager1-121/+230
2019-11-26Log more details when IdentifyNewAdapter failsDavid Lönnhager1-1/+3
2019-11-15Correct recent changes in 'driverlogic'Odd Stranne1-2/+2
2019-10-18Remove only the TAP driver if it's not being used by other adapters onDavid Lönnhager1-12/+200
2019-04-17Make driverlogic module aware of updated TAP naming schemeOdd Stranne1-2/+35
2018-11-19Replace text parsing and WMI calls in 'driverlogic'Odd Stranne1-171/+70
2018-11-09Update 'driverlogic' to get controlled destruction of 'Connection' instanceOdd Stranne1-8/+9
2018-10-03Identify network interface based on nodeOdd Stranne1-3/+34
2018-09-04Add logging in 'driverlogic' pluginOdd Stranne1-0/+79
2018-07-10Add NSIS plugin for aiding in driver installationOdd Stranne1-0/+132